Abstract
A needleless drug particle delivery device, of the kind in which firing of the drug particles is caused by a sudden gas flow, characterised in that the device comprises a container (14) of compressed gas and a mechanism for releasing the gas from the container to create the gas flow, the mechanism comprising a rupture (20) element for breaching the container and a manually manipulable actuator (27) for moving the element and the container relatively to one another to provide an initial breach whereby gas is released to act on a piston portion (21) to provide a servo action which causes the rupture element and container to move further suddenly relatively to one another to complete the breaching of the container and establish a maximum gas flow from the container.

10. A particle delivery device for firing particles at a target surface using a sudden gas flow, characterized in that said device comprises a container of compressed gas, an element for breaching the container to release the compressed gas when the element and container are moved relative to each other, and an adjustable stop for limiting the relative movement of the element and container, whereby said adjustable stop provides an adjustable restriction on the maximum outflow of gas from the container.
